[PATCH v5 0/2] refs: fix some bugs with batched-updates

In 23fc8e4f61 (refs: implement batch reference update support,
2025-04-08) we introduced a mechanism to batch reference updates. The
idea being that we wanted to batch updates similar to a transaction, but
allow certain updates to fail. This would help reference backends
optimize such operations and also remove the overhead of processing
updates individually. Especially for the reftable backend, where
batching updates would ensure that the autocompaction would only occur
at the end of the batch instead of after every reference update.

As of 9d2962a7c4 (receive-pack: use batched reference updates,
2025-05-19) we also updated the 'git-fetch(1)' and 'git-receive-pack(1)'
command to use batched reference updates. This series fixes some bugs
that we found at GitLab by running our Gitaly service with the `next`
build of Git.

The first being in the files backend, which missed skipping over failed
updates in certain flows. When certain individual updates fail, we mark
them as such. However, we missed skipping over such failed updates,
which can cause a SEGFAULT.

The other is in the git-receive-pack(1) implementation when a user
pushes multiple branches such as:

  delete refs/heads/branch/conflict
  create refs/heads/branch

Before using batched updates, the references would be applied
sequentially and hence no conflicts would arise. With batched updates,
while the first update applies, the second fails due to F/D conflict. A
similar issue was present in 'git-fetch(1)' and was fixed by using
separating out reference pruning into a separate transaction. Apply a
similar mechanism for 'git-receive-pack(1)' and separate out reference
deletions into its own batch.
